Healthcare faces a fundamental economic problem: supply and demand.
While the demand for healthcare professionals keeps rising, the number of qualified workers isn’t maintaining pace.
Some experts predict that by 2025, the U.S. will have employment shortages as high as 29,000 nurse practitioners, 96,000 nursing assistants, 98,000 technicians, and 446,000 home health aids.
Unfortunately, healthcare staffing shortages aren’t limited to these traditional frontline workers. As providers and provider support systems become emaciated, other skilled professionals, like medical coders, are also
seeing shortfalls as high as 30%, spreading healthcare teams thinner.
This lack of talent makes recruiting skilled employees daunting for healthcare facilities that require specialized workers to deliver high-quality care. As the pool of qualified workers shrinks in proportion to demand, more and more responsibilities are being placed on the shoulders of the few healthcare professionals who enter the ring.

An increasing number of healthcare organizations are embracing remote staffing to gain better access to qualified medical staff. The Medical Group Management Association reports that nearly 35% of the healthcare industry has already gone remote.
Remote staffing offers many benefits, especially concerning cost reduction and employee retention. Generally speaking, employing remote medical professionals eliminates the need for physical office space, reduces overhead costs, and saves time commuting. Additionally, remote staffing allows access to a broader talent pool, as healthcare organizations can tap into a global workforce, regardless of geographic location.
Furthermore, remote workers and the teams they support enjoy a better work-life balance, which can lead to better overall employee satisfaction. The medical industry faces a unique challenge due to increasing employment costs, which are up 257% in only three years. Many medical professionals expect a hefty sum for their hard work and expertise, and rightly so, but with a shortage of staff, this burden can become too much to bear.
Besides increasing wages, the costs associated with training and maintaining staff are exorbitant. This combination has made it increasingly difficult for medical facilities to retain quality workers. These shortages can lead to longer wait times, subpar care, or even medical errors.
